P-Pop (aka Pinoy Pop), a genre of contemporary music originating in the Philippines, has been gaining worldwide momentum in the last decade or so, and one of the groups leading the way is the incredibly talented boy band SB19! On the scene since 2018, the Manila-based 5-some went through training and formation similar to many of our favorite K-Pop artists, and the results speak for themselves! During their stop in L.A. for their international 'Where You At Tour', Pablo, Stell, Ken, Justin, and Josh sat down with Young Hollywood so we could get to know them a little better! Find out what they love best about L.A., the inspiration behind their comeback single "WYAT (Where You At)", their tour must-haves, and which one of them takes the longest to get ready, plus they play a game of "Heads Up"!
